Company Overview CanaDream is one of Canada’s leading RV rental and sales companies. We offer a wide range of RVs, including camperized vans, motorhomes, and truck campers, for both rental and purchase. With seven locations across Canada, including Calgary and Edmonton (Alberta), Vancouver (British Columbia), Whitehorse (Yukon), Toronto (Ontario), Montreal (Quebec) and Halifax (Nova Scotia), we provide our guests with the opportunity to explore Canada at their own pace. Enjoy the very best Canadian hospitality from our incredible Crew, who service, prepare, and deliver a wow factor for every rental and purchase. Our mission is to deliver a first‑class RV vacation experience, and we pride ourselves on our exceptional customer service and high‑quality vehicles. Essential Duties and Responsibilities Administrative Support: Assist with general office tasks such as filing, data entry, internal communications, and document preparation. Mail & Courier Handling: Help receive, sort, and distribute incoming mail and prepare and track outgoing shipments. Office Supplies: Monitor inventory and assist with ordering, organising and distributing supplies. Uniform Coordination: Organise, track, distribute, and maintain the documentation of staff uniforms. Event Support: Coordinate office social events and activities and assist in arranging and organising corporate level events. Travel Assistance: Assist with booking travel and tracking related expenses. Fleet Support: Provide support for fleet movements and monitor related expenses. Team Collaboration: Support team members to support various projects and tasks as requested Other Duties: Take on additional responsibilities as assigned. Qualifications and Skills High School Diploma required; post‑secondary coursework in Business Administration is an asset. 2‑3 years of experience in an office or customer service environment preferred.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ook). Strong communication and interpersonal skills. Excellent organisational skills and attention to detail. Willingness to learn and take initiative. Ability to work independently and as part of a team. Working Conditions Office‑based role with regular interaction with staff and guests. Use of computers and office equipment required. Some heavy lifting may be required May involve repetitive tasks and extended periods of sitting and standing. Occasional overtime may be requested.
